Alita Blanchard on Embracing Imperfection, Navigating Infant Loss, and Her Awakening as a Woman and Mother

Hi everyone, this week I chat to Alita Blanchard, who is a Parent Coach and Founder of Theawaremama.com.au We first connected through Instagram, where I relate to so much of her content and energy, and I’m excited to be bringing this conversation with her to you today.
Through her work, Alita holds space for mothers and helps them soften their high expectations of themselves and gently learn new skills to help them feel more safe, seen, soothed and secure, so that they can offer the same connection and co-regulation to their children.
During our discussion, Alita opens up about her experience of motherhood and the profound awakening it brought with it, describing it as “the ultimate breakdown” and the catalyst behind deep personal growth. She shares with me the insights that motherhood provided her with, surrounding her attachment style, emotional suppression, and the elements of herself and her life that weren’t aligned with her true authenticity. We also discuss Alita’s contrasting experiences of parenting her different children, as well as the heartbreaking grief she endured following the loss of her fourth child, which was yet another portal of change and introspection.
In this conversation we also discuss the importance of self-compassion in mothering, embracing imperfection, the inherent flaws in so many schools of thought with regards to parenting that perpetuate the myth of “the perfect mother” and how this can create shame, the role attachment theory can play in how we parent, and we define what “village” means to us when it comes to child-rearing, the different ways this can look and why it is so important when it comes to support.
This is a rich conversation and I hope you get as much value from Alita’s perspective and wisdom that I did.
